## Role-Based Access for Plugin Authors

The Mossgate wiki assigns every plugin a role scope at install time: `reader`, `curator`, or `steward`. External plugin authors should request the narrowest scope that satisfies their feature, since steward-level plugins can rewrite permission trees. Scope grants are validated against the Hallowell policy service on every request, and your plugin authenticates to that service using a credential stored in its env file. The line immediately following this paragraph in that file sets the credential.

env line for fafof-fahag: LEDGER_TOKEN5=f8790

The Dunmere chip reader now debounces duplicate mat crossings instead of trusting the firmware. Runners doubling back near the Ashfell split were getting ghost reads; we drop repeats inside the suppression window and keep the earliest timestamp. Don't shrink that window without rerunning the relay-race fixtures — lead-leg handoffs are the tight case. Current windows and retry limits are set as follows.

tuning table, yajog-yahof:
BUDGETS = {
    "lamvan": 303,
    "wenox": 460,
    "fenvan": 525,
}

Ticket: Config drift on telemetry compression (Pylon-Relay)

The Pylon-Relay collectors in the Norvale cluster are running mismatched compression settings. Three nodes use zstd level 9 while the baseline specifies level 3, inflating CPU and skewing payload-size alerts. No data loss observed, but drift bypassed change review. Requesting security sign-off before we reconcile, since compression settings interact with the payload signing step. Current baseline for reference follows below.

service settings:
[casax]
port = 6379
team = rusir
host = casax.zemvarhq.corp
region = outer-4
access_code = ac_9808ce
timeout_ms = 1500